Canada opens Gordie Howe bridge without US officials amid worsening trade dispute
Canada has marked the opening of the Gordie Howe International Bridge with a quiet ceremony that did not include United States officials. The bridge links Windsor, Ontario, and Detroit, Michigan, and the opening came after Canada cancelled a planned cross-border ribbon-cutting event. The ceremony was held on Friday, with the bridge due to open to traffic on Monday.The event took place against a backdrop of rising tension between the two countries over toll-sharing and new tariff threats from US President Donald Trump. Canada cancels joint Gordie Howe Bridge opening ceremony amid tariff dispute
Canada has cancelled a planned joint ribbon-cutting ceremony for the Gordie Howe International Bridge after Donald Trump announced a 50% tariff on most Canadian goods. The bridge, which links Detroit and Windsor, Ontario, is still expected to open to traffic later this month. Canadian officials said the celebratory event would no longer be appropriate in light of the threatened trade action.A spokesperson for Canadian Infrastructure Minister Gregor Robertson said the decision followed the latest escalation in trade tensions between the two countries.
